Transaction 77c2157669917c820930990f693fa1d974c6fbaf63e4538d748b2c60f377edac
2 Input
2 Outputs
- 77c2157669917c820930990f693fa1d974c6fbaf63e4538d748b2c60f377edac:0
- 77c2157669917c820930990f693fa1d974c6fbaf63e4538d748b2c60f377edac:1
value 1161532
address 1EvbVxx5y7dUAAPugnwXGs4B7QKBSC5eMX
value 29237885
address 3LaQZ31HSY2ED9iMbw2CuivFhhGKk7FYJa